U+1CA8 "" Georgian Mtavruli Capital Letter Shin is a capital letter form of the Georgian script's "shin" (შ), used in the Mtavruli style, which is a majuscule or uppercase variant distinct from the standard "Mkhedruli" lowercase Georgian letters. This character represents the voiceless palato-alveolar fricative sound /ʃ/, equivalent to the English "sh" in "ship", and is primarily employed in modern Georgian typography for headings, titles, or decorative emphasis, as well as in historical inscriptions. It is part of the Georgian Extended block in Unicode, added in version 11.0 (2018) to support formal capitalization within the Georgian writing system, which traditionally lacks case distinctions but adopted Mtavruli for such purposes in contemporary usage.
